CMP3001 Operating SystemsBahçeşehir UniversityDegree Programs FOREIGN TRADE (TURKISH, DISTANCE EDUCATION)General Information For StudentsDiploma SupplementErasmus Policy StatementNational QualificationsBologna Commission
FOREIGN TRADE (TURKISH, DISTANCE EDUCATION)
Associate TR-NQF-HE: Level 5 QF-EHEA: Short Cycle EQF-LLL: Level 5

Ders Genel Tanıtım Bilgileri

Course Code: CMP3001
Ders İsmi: Operating Systems
Ders Yarıyılı: Spring
Fall
Ders Kredileri:
Theoretical Practical Credit ECTS
3 0 3 6
Language of instruction: English
Ders Koşulu:
Ders İş Deneyimini Gerektiriyor mu?: No
Type of course: Non-Departmental Elective
Course Level:
Associate TR-NQF-HE:5. Master`s Degree QF-EHEA:Short Cycle EQF-LLL:5. Master`s Degree
Mode of Delivery: Face to face
Course Coordinator : Dr. Öğr. Üyesi TARKAN AYDIN
Course Lecturer(s):
Course Assistants:

Dersin Amaç ve İçeriği

Course Objectives: This course is a core course on one of the pillars of computer systems: Operating Systems (OS). The course will make the student appreciate things he takes for granted such as process management, file systems, and so on. It will also help him/her make an entry into the domains of efficient use of OSes and OS design.
Course Content: 1.History of Operating Systems, Introduction to Operating Systems
2.Processes and Threads
3.Memory Management
4.File Systems
5.Input Output
6.Deadlocks

Learning Outcomes

The students who have succeeded in this course;
Learning Outcomes
1 - Knowledge
Theoretical - Conceptual
2 - Skills
Cognitive - Practical
3 - Competences
Communication and Social Competence
Learning Competence
Field Specific Competence
Competence to Work Independently and Take Responsibility

Ders Akış Planı

Week Subject Related Preparation
1) History of Operating Systems, Introduction to Operating Systems None
2) Processes and Threads None
3) Processes and Threads (cont.) None
4) Process Synchronization None
5) CPU Scheduling
6) Midterm Study all the topics covered so far
7) Deadlocks None
8) Deadlocks (cont) None
9) Memory Management None
10) Virtual Memory None
11) Virtual Memory None
12) Storage management None
13) File Systems None
14) File Systems (cont) None

Sources

Course Notes / Textbooks: Operating System Concepts
Abraham Silberschatz (Author), Peter B. Galvin (Author), Greg Gagne (Author)
References: Andrew S. Tanenbaum, Modern Operating Systems, (3rd Edition), 2007, Prentice Hall

Ders - Program Öğrenme Kazanım İlişkisi

Ders Öğrenme Kazanımları
Program Outcomes

Ders - Öğrenme Kazanımı İlişkisi

No Effect 1 Lowest 2 Low 3 Average 4 High 5 Highest
           
Program Outcomes Level of Contribution

Öğrenme Etkinliği ve Öğretme Yöntemleri

Ölçme ve Değerlendirme Yöntemleri ve Kriterleri

Assessment & Grading

Semester Requirements Number of Activities Level of Contribution
Quizzes 8 % 20
Project 1 % 10
Midterms 1 % 30
Final 1 % 40
Total % 100
PERCENTAGE OF SEMESTER WORK % 60
PERCENTAGE OF FINAL WORK % 40
Total % 100

İş Yükü ve AKTS Kredisi Hesaplaması

Activities Number of Activities Duration (Hours) Workload
Course Hours 14 3 42
Study Hours Out of Class 14 2 28
Project 1 10 10
Quizzes 8 1 8
Midterms 1 25 25
Final 1 35 35
Total Workload 148